📅 Mother’s Day 2026 Date Guide

Mother’s Day in the Philippines is celebrated on the second Sunday of May. In 2026, it falls on Sunday, May 10, 2026. It is not a public holiday, but it is one of the busiest days for families, restaurants, and malls.

💖 Meaning and How Filipinos Celebrate

Mother's Day

Mother’s Day in the Philippines is simple but very meaningful. It is about making your mom feel loved. We call her the “Ilaw ng Tahanan,” the one who takes care of everyone. It is not only for moms. Many families also celebrate grandmothers, aunts, or older sisters who helped raise them.

How Filipinos usually celebrate

  • Eat together as a family, either at home or outside
  • Buy flowers, cake, or a small gift
  • Go to the mall or have a simple day out
  • Stay home, watch movies, and just spend time together

Modern 2026 touches you will see

  • More people using apps like GCash or Maya to send money or pay for last-minute gifts
  • Ordering flowers or cake online, especially last minute
  • Small but thoughtful surprises like food deliveries or “pabaon” for Mom

Why it feels special in the Philippines

  • Strong family values make this day very personal and meaningful
  • Moms are seen as the heart of the home, so even simple gestures matter
  • Celebrations often include extended family, making it feel warmer and more complete

💐 Flower Buying Tips

Mother's Day Flower Buying Tips

Flowers are one of the easiest gifts, but in real life, timing and choice matter. Here are simple tips so you do not end up rushing or overpaying.

1. Carnations are still a classic

If you are not sure what to buy, carnations are always okay. You can find them almost everywhere, even last minute. They last longer, which helps in hot weather. Pink and white are the usual picks.

2. Mixed bouquets feel more personal

If you want something a bit nicer, go for mixed flowers. Roses, lilies, sunflowers, or tulips together look more thoughtful. It feels like you picked it specially for your mom, not just grabbed something fast.

💰 2026 Price Guide (Estimated in PHP)

Prices go up fast during Mother’s Day week, especially near May 10.

  • Carnations: ₱1,200 to ₱1,800
  • Local roses (Baguio/Benguet): ₱1,000 to ₱2,500
  • Ecuadorian roses (premium): ₱3,500 to ₱6,000+
  • Sunflowers: ₱1,500 to ₱2,800
  • Tulips (imported): ₱3,000 to ₱5,000
Tip: If you wait until the last few days, choices become limited and prices are higher.

3. Order early to avoid stress

This is the most important one. Florists get fully booked very fast. If you order late, you might only get leftover designs or bad delivery time slots. Even ordering 3 to 5 days earlier already makes a big difference.

✨ Simple Tips to Make Flowers Last Longer

  • Add a bit of sugar or clear soda to the water
  • Do not put flowers under direct sun
  • Change the water if you can
  • Use cold water for tulips or lilies

🎂 Cake Ideas and Tips

Mother's Day Cake

In the Philippines, cake is usually the center of Mother’s Day. This is the moment everyone waits for, when you gather, sing, and take photos. Simple or fancy, what matters is your mom enjoys it.

1. Choose what your mom actually likes

Do not just follow trends. Think about what she always orders or talks about.
Popular choices:

  • pandan cake
  • chocolate cake
  • cheesecake
  • mango or fruit shortcake
  • butter cake

What people are trying more in 2026:

  • ube with cheese frosting, not too sweet
  • Mango Bravo style cakes like Conti’s, with layers and crunch
  • matcha or pistachio for something different

2. Pick the right bakery for your plan

  • Simple and budget friendly: Red Ribbon, Goldilocks
  • Family favorites: Conti’s, Mary Grace
  • More premium look: Dylan Patisserie, Bizu

3. Pre order early to avoid stress

  • Cake shops get very busy during Mother’s Day weekend
  • Custom messages and designs can run out fast
  • Popular pickup time slots get fully booked
  • Last minute orders usually have very limited choices
✨ 2026 tip: Try to order between May 4 to May 8. If you wait until May 10, you might end up choosing whatever is left.

🍽️ Dining Ideas for Mother’s Day

Mother's Day Dining

In the Philippines, food is always the main part of the celebration. For May 10, 2026, expect long lines and full restaurants, so planning ahead really helps.

1. Buffet and big group dining

  • Buffets are still the top choice for big families
  • Places like Vikings and Tong Yang are popular because everyone can pick what they like
  • Some promos like “4+1” may not be available on Mother’s Day
  • Hotel buffets in Makati are a better option if you want a calmer setting

2. Restaurants with a specific vibe

  • Good if your mom prefers something more personal than a buffet
  • Cafes and restaurants in Taguig or Makati are popular choices
  • Pick based on her style, cozy cafe, garden dining, or steak place
  • Reserve at least 1 to 2 weeks early to avoid full slots

3. Home celebration with a special touch

  • Best if you want to avoid traffic and waiting
  • Order party trays from Conti’s or other local spots
  • Try grazing boxes or platters for a nicer setup
  • Brunch boxes with pastries, fruits, and coffee are trending for 2026
